WebMay 25, 2024 · When submitting the C100 form, there is a Court fee of £232.00 (unless you are exempt from paying Court fees) which will need to be paid at the time of submitting your application. If you are raising concerns that a child has suffered, or is at risk of suffering, domestic abuse or violence, then you will need to complete Form C1A and file this ... If independent legal advice from a solicitor is sought, then there will also be legal fees to consider. hope facs hobart indiana npiWebApr 1, 2024 · The proposal will affect 133 Court fees including the following Family Court fees: Issuing a Divorce Petition will be increased from £550 to £592. Issuing a C100 Application in Children Act proceedings will be increased from £215 to £232. Issuing an Application for a Financial Order will be increased from £255 to £275. longo\u0027s grocery
